What We’ll Do

Our 2 day group workshop is an inspiring experience. Working hands on with master yurt builder Mattimus you will work with the other participents to construct a complete 14 foot Yurt, you will learn the skills and gain the experience you need to construct your own yurt of any size and style.

Throughout the weekend you will learn traditional and modern styles of yurt construction taking you through 4000 years of yurt history. You do not need any pre-exisiting skills or experience to participate in this wonderful weekend workshop.

Meet your host, Matt Larivee

Foxfire Heritage Farm is a small farm dedicated dedicated to the preservation of endangered heritage breed animals, traditional skills and lifestyle through sustainable practices. Owner Matt Larivee is a passionate individual focused on bettering the earth around him. In 2021, Matt won the Northern Spark Tourism Award and was a panelist at the 2022 Canador College Sustainability Summit.
